what is the equation of the line that is perpendicular to the y-axis and contains the point (2,11)

Respuesta :

sqdancefan
sqdancefan sqdancefan
  • 10-04-2020

Answer:

  y = 11

Step-by-step explanation:

The y-axis is a vertical line. A perpendicular line will be a horizontal line. A horizontal line has an equation of the form ...

  y = constant

In order for the line to go through a point with a y-value of 11, the constant in the equation must be 11. Your line is ...

  y = 11
